Lagos State Government has commenced the retrofitting of streetlights from High-Pressure Sodium Bulb to Light Emitting Diode across the state.Revealing this in an official statement on Sunday, the General Manager, Lagos State Electricity Board , Engr. Mukhtaar Tijani explained that the LED lighting system is in consonance with the present administration’s effort to have a smart electricity network that will improve the socio-economic resilience of the city.

According to him, to make a profound impact in the drive towards power sustainability and optimization of energy use in the state, significant change in investment is required and the board is appropriately adopting this conventional scheme to promote energy efficiency and management. Tijani affirmed that the adoption of this form of resourceful energy practice in public spaces across the State will enhance operating efficiency and improve business practices.
